**Stakeholder Engagement & Regulatory Coordinator**
- _Salary: _97,955 to $111,142 (_Plus superannuation)_
- _Fixed-Term position until 30 June 2026_
- _Usual hours of work: Full time _
- _Usual work location_ _Morwell Gov Hub, 65 Church Street, Morwell VIC 3840_

**The Role**

As a Stakeholder Engagement & Regulatory Coordinator, you will be supporting the engagement of key stakeholders, especially in relation to effective delivery of communication to landowners in the Gippsland region. Your time will be divided between two teams, Environment and Stakeholder Engagement with time allocations based on a documented work program with scheduled deliverables.

Your expertise in working for major projects has been developed in the carbon capture and storage sector. These skills are supported by strong communication and writing skills.

This role is for someone who enjoys providing a high-level customer service and enjoys stakeholder engagement within a fast pace and dynamic environment. You will have demonstrated project management skills and/or the ability to co-ordinate a range of activities to support project outcomes. To be successful in the role, you will need flexibility and adaptability to work across multi-disciplinary teams and develop effective working relationships with key stakeholders.

**Key accountabilities include**:

- Working closely with the project directors to assist with land-owner liaison and stakeholder engagement, this will include the maintenance of landowner registers and developing communications with landholders and key stakeholders.
- Assist broader stakeholder engagement and communication for the project including the production and distribution of printed, digital and display marketing materials including developing and publishing digital content, supporting the production of events, online forums and CarbonNet's monthly eNewsletter while working to established budget and timeframes.
- Assist with preparing letters, FAQs, briefs and presentations.
- Support the Environment and Regulatory Affairs and Storage teams, the Project Director and extended leadership team in the delivery of a range of projects and activities including administration, procurement, policy and research.
- Help maintain effective working relationships with key stakeholders across the department, Victorian and Commonwealth agencies, regulators, industry, and the wider community.
